    When Brian first began to use the bow and arrows he could not catch fish because _______________.

    • A.

      Brian’s arrows were not sharp enough to pierce the skin of the fish

    • B.

      Brian was not fast enough to hit the fish and they swam away

    • C.

      The water bent the light making the fish look like they were in a different place than where they really were

    • D.

      The fish stayed in the deep water and Brian could not get close enough to catch them

    Correct Answer
    C. The water bent the light making the fish look like they were in a different place than where they really were
    Explanation
    Brian first began to use the bow and arrows, he could not catch fish because the water bent the light, causing the fish to appear in a different place than their actual location. This optical illusion made it difficult for Brian to accurately aim and hit the fish with his arrows.

    What is the main conflict of Hatchet and how is it resolved?

    • A.

      Brian is sprayed by a skunk and must take four baths a day to get rid of the smell.

    • B.

      Brian is alone in the wilderness and must learn how to take care of himself.

    • C.

      Brian is angry with his mother over the secret and his mother tells her boyfriend to go away.

    • D.

      Brian and Terry get lost and they must find their way home.

    Correct Answer
    B. Brian is alone in the wilderness and must learn how to take care of himself.
    Explanation
    In the novel "Hatchet", the main conflict revolves around Brian being stranded alone in the wilderness after a plane crash. He must learn how to survive and take care of himself in this unfamiliar and harsh environment. This conflict is resolved as Brian gradually learns essential survival skills, overcomes various challenges, and ultimately manages to be rescued and return home.
